Determining if a processor is in shared processor mode is not a constant so don't hide it behind a #define. Signed-off-by: Christopher M. Riedl <redacted> --- arch/powerpc/include/asm/spinlock.h | 21 +++++++++++++++------ 1 file changed, 15 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)diff --git a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/spinlock.h b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/spinlock.h index a47f827bc5f1..8631b0b4e109 100644 --- a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/spinlock.h +++ b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/spinlock.h@@ -101,15 +101,24 @@ static inline int arch_spin_trylock(arch_spinlock_t *lock) #if defined(CONFIG_PPC_SPLPAR) /* We only yield to the hypervisor if we are in shared processor mode */ -#define SHARED_PROCESSOR (lppaca_shared_proc(local_paca->lppaca_ptr)) extern void __spin_yield(arch_spinlock_t *lock); extern void __rw_yield(arch_rwlock_t *lock); #else /* SPLPAR */ #define __spin_yield(x) barrier() #define __rw_yield(x) barrier() -#define SHARED_PROCESSOR 0 #endif +static inline bool is_shared_processor(void) +{ +/* Only server processors have an lppaca struct */ +#ifdef CONFIG_PPC_BOOK3S + return (IS_ENABLED(CONFIG_PPC_SPLPAR) && + lppaca_shared_proc(local_paca->lppaca_ptr)); +#else + return false; +#endif +} +CONFIG_PPC_SPLPAR depends on CONFIG_PPC_PSERIES, which depends on CONFIG_PPC_BOOK3S so the #ifdef above is unnecessary: if CONFIG_PPC_BOOK3S is unset then CONFIG_PPC_SPLPAR will be unset as well and the return expression should short-circuit to false.
Agreed, but the #ifdef is necessary to compile platforms which include this header but do not implement lppaca_shared_proc(...) and friends. I can reword the comment if that helps.
